Output 6e30344444f0f5d0f29b8f5a1b53fb3644fc7c93991533ca58a602385b2a896e:0

value
12717960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a672ef88c5992495dbb4f6a427cb8b4774aae1 OP_EQUAL
address
3DbqAZMncMaVWm9ryEmnXnDBLSYCuzRAsW
transaction
6e30344444f0f5d0f29b8f5a1b53fb3644fc7c93991533ca58a602385b2a896e
spent
true